Shipwrecks, legal landscapes and Mediterranean paradigms : : gone under sea. / / by Emilia Mataix Ferrándiz.
This book changes our understanding of the Roman conceptions about the sea by placing the focus on shipwrecks as events that act as bridges between the sea and the land. The study explores the different Roman legal definitions of these spaces, and how individuals of divergent legal statuses interact...
